The Prelude: What is Intellectual Property?
At the heart of our journey into the world of IP lies a fundamental question: What exactly is intellectual property? Ip Insightful Navigating Ideas begins with comprehending this core concept. Intellectual property encompasses a spectrum of creations of the mind, ranging from inventions and literary works to symbols, names, and designs used in commerce.
The Symphony of Ideas: Types of Intellectual Property
- Trademarks: Often the face of a brand, trademarks are distinctive symbols or expressions protecting products or services. Think about the iconic swoosh symbolizing Nike.
- Copyrights: These safeguard original literary, artistic, or musical works. Whether it’s a bestselling novel or a mesmerizing piece of music, copyrights provide the shield against unauthorized reproduction.
- Patents: When it comes to groundbreaking inventions, patents take the spotlight. They grant exclusive rights to inventors, encouraging innovation by ensuring they reap the benefits of their creations.
- Trade Secrets: Guarded like treasures, trade secrets include confidential business information providing companies with a competitive edge. The Coca-Cola formula is a classic example.
- Design Patents: Elevating aesthetics to a legal status, design patents protect the ornamental aspects of an object, preventing others from copying its unique appearance.

Unraveling the Complexity: Common Misconceptions
1. Myth: Ideas Alone Are Protectable
Reality: While ideas are the seeds of innovation, they, in themselves, are not protectable under intellectual property law. Protection comes into play when those ideas are manifested in tangible forms, such as inventions, designs, or creative works.
2. Myth: Intellectual Property is Only for Big Corporations
Reality: The realm of IP is democratic, extending its arms to individuals, startups, and small businesses. Whether you’re an independent inventor or a burgeoning entrepreneur, Ip Insightful Navigating Ideas is equally relevant and accessible.
3. Myth: Once Granted, IP Rights Last Indefinitely
Reality: IP rights, while providing exclusivity, are not eternal. Patents, for example, have a limited duration. Understanding the timeline of protection is crucial for effective IP management and strategic planning.
